Comparison Overview

The 2025 Lexus RC captivates with its dedicated coupe silhouette and the velvety refinement expected from the brand, promising an elegant RWD experience despite producing a modest 241 hp. In contrast, the 2026 Genesis G70, while a slightly smaller sedan at 184.4 inches long, immediately grabs attention with a superior 300 hp output, boasting 59 more horses for explosive acceleration. The G70 also offers better raw torque at 311 lb-ft versus the Lexus's 258 lb-ft, making it the clear performance frontrunner. Both demand premium unleaded fuel and feature an 8-speed automatic transmission, but the Lexus edges out slightly on efficiency with a 25 MPG combined rating compared to the G70's 24 MPG. With an MSRP starting at $45,620, the RC asks for a premium over the G70's $43,450 entry price, positioning them in a close battle of style versus outright capability.

Our Verdicts

๐Ÿš— Best for Commuters

2025 Lexus RC

The Lexus RC wins for commuters due to its slightly superior combined fuel economy rating of 25 MPG.

๐Ÿ‘จโ€๐Ÿ‘ฉโ€๐Ÿ‘งโ€๐Ÿ‘ฆ Best for Families

2026 Genesis G70

The Genesis G70 wins due to its superior practicality as a sedan with 10.5 cu ft of cargo space, narrowly beating the RC coupe's 10.4 cu ft.

๐ŸŽ๏ธ Best for Enthusiasts

2026 Genesis G70

The G70 is the enthusiast's choice, delivering a substantial performance advantage with 300 hp and 311 lb-ft of torque.

๐Ÿ’ฐ Best Value

2026 Genesis G70

The Genesis G70 offers significantly more horsepower (300 hp vs. 241 hp) for a lower starting MSRP of $43,450.

Choose the Lexus RC if...

  • You prioritize sleek coupe styling over four-door utility, accepting the 185.0-inch length.
  • You desire the absolute maximum efficiency in this pairing, netting 25 MPG combined.
  • You value the traditional luxury refinement associated with the Lexus brand at its $45,620 starting point.

Choose the Genesis G70 if...

  • You demand thrilling acceleration, supported by the G70's class-leading 300 horsepower.
  • You need the best dollar-to-performance ratio, saving $2,170 compared to the Lexus entry price.
  • You require the slight advantage in utility provided by its 10.5 cubic feet of cargo capacity.

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about comparing the 2025 Lexus RC and 2026 Genesis G70.

How much faster is the Genesis G70 than the Lexus RC in straight-line performance?

The G70 is significantly faster, boasting 300 horsepower, which is 59 more than the Lexus RC's 241 hp. This massive power gap, combined with 311 lb-ft of torque, means the G70 will outperform the RC easily.

Which vehicle is slightly better on fuel economy for daily driving?

The 2025 Lexus RC is marginally more efficient, achieving a 25 MPG combined rating compared to the 2026 Genesis G70's 24 MPG combined. Both require the use of premium unleaded fuel for their respective engines.

Is the Lexus RC or the Genesis G70 easier to maneuver in tight city parking?

The Genesis G70 is technically more compact in overall length at 184.4 inches compared to the Lexus RC's 185.0 inches. However, the G70 is slightly wider at 72.8 inches, while the RC offers a smaller footprint height-wise at 54.9 inches.

Are both models exclusively rear-wheel drive?

Yes, both the 2025 Lexus RC and the 2026 Genesis G70 are specified as rear-wheel drive vehicles, mated to an 8-speed shiftable automatic transmission.

How does the cargo capacity compare between the coupe and the sedan?

The Genesis G70 sedan offers a minuscule advantage in practicality with 10.5 cubic feet of cargo space. The Lexus RC coupe provides 10.4 cubic feet, illustrating the typical trade-off between dedicated coupe styling and sedan utility.

What is the price difference between these two powerful, premium contenders?

The 2026 Genesis G70 starts at a lower MSRP of $43,450, offering great performance value. The 2025 Lexus RC commands a slightly higher starting price of $45,620.
